Following a decisive victory over the United Arab Emirates (UAE) in the opening match of the Dabur Honey Sponsored Nepal T20I Triangular Series, Nepal is gearing up to face their longtime rival, Hong Kong, on 19th October.

This encounter will mark the first T20 International clash between Nepal and Hong Kong in almost three years. In their previous face-off in 2020, Nepal had been bowled out for 111 while chasing a target of 155 runs. Since that game, the trajectories of the two teams have diverged significantly.

The Nepal vs. Hong Kong match is scheduled at Mulpani Cricket Ground, Mulpani, with a kickoff time of 11 am Nepali time.

Team Updates



The Cricket Association of Nepal (CAN) has unveiled an 18-player roster for the tri-series. Sandeep Lamichhane won't be joining due to personal reasons.

Lalit Rajbanshi, previously sidelined for the Asian Games due to an injury, is back on the team. Additionally, Lokesh Bam and Surya Tamang have been added to the squad for evaluation.

Nepal Squad: Rohit Paudel (captain), Aasif Sheikh (wicketkeeper), Kushal Bhurtel, Kushal Malla, Dipendra Singh Airee, Sundeep Jora, Gulsan Jha, Sompal Kami, Karan KC, Pratis GC, Lalit Rajbanshi, Avinash Bohara, Bibek Yadav, Sagar Dhakal, Binod Bhandari (wicketkeeper), Lokesh Bam, Surya Tamang, Mausam Dhakal. 

Hong Kong Squad: Nizakat Khan (captain), Adit Gorawara, Aizaz Khan, Ayush Shukla, Anshuman Rath, Babar Hayat, Ehsan Khan, Mohammad Ghazanfar, Haroon Arshad, Nasrulla Rana, Martin Coetzee, Raag Kapur, Scott Mckechnie, Yasim Murtaza, Zeeshan Ali.
